Understanding the Importance of Emergency Window Repair
Why Timely Repair is Crucial
When a window is damaged, it can lead to a wide range of problems, including:
- Security Risks: Broken windows jeopardize safety, making homes and companies more susceptible to burglaries.
- Weather condition Vulnerability: Gaps triggered by broken windows can result in drafts, water damage, and mold development.
- Energy Inefficiency: Damaged windows can increase heating & cooling expenses by allowing air to get away.

When facing a window emergency, follow these steps to make sure a safe and quick resolution:
- Assess the Damage: Determine how severe the damage is. If glass is broken, clear the area of any sharp pieces to avoid injury.
- Protect the Area: Use plywood or cardboard to cover large openings briefly. This action helps stay out trespassers and secures versus weather condition.
- Contact Professionals: Reach out to emergency window repair services. Try to find business with 24/7 schedule to guarantee a fast response time.
- Document the Damage: Take photos of the damage for insurance functions. This paperwork can assist simplify the claims procedure.
- Follow Up: After the emergency repair, think about setting up a more permanent solution, such as a complete window replacement or more comprehensive repairs.
Types of Emergency Window Repairs
Depending on the nature and extent of the damage, several kinds of repairs may be carried out:
1. Glass Replacement
This includes changing shattered or split glass panes while keeping the window frame intact. Various types of glass can be used, consisting of tempered or laminated glass, depending upon the requirements.
2. Board-Up Services
For seriously harmed windows, professional services might board up the window to provide instant security and protection from the elements.
3. Frame Repair
Sometimes, the window frame itself might be damaged. In such cases, repairs might include replacing or enhancing wood or metal framing.
4. Lock Replacement
If the window lock is broken, it needs to be replaced to make sure security. A locksmith professional can rapidly handle this repair.
5. Seal Replacement
If there are drafts, it could suggest a broken seal. A professional can change weather condition stripping or caulking to enhance energy efficiency.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q1: How can I avoid window damage in the future?
A1: Regular maintenance, consisting of cleansing and checking seals, can help prevent damage. Additionally, consider storm windows or impact-resistant glass in locations prone to serious weather condition.
Q2: What should I do if my window is broken after business hours?
A2: Contact a window repair service that uses 24/7 emergency help. Lots of reputable companies have emergency procedures to handle such scenarios.
Q3: Can I repair my window myself?
A3: Minor repairs, like replacing weather removing, can often be done personally. However, for considerable damage, professional assistance is recommended for security and efficiency.
Q4: Will my insurance coverage cover the expense of window repair?
A4: Most house owner’s insurance plan cover window damage, but it’s vital to talk to your company. Documenting free estimate can support your claim.
Q5: How long does window repair normally take?
A5: The time it takes to finish a window repair differs depending on the damage. Minor repairs can be carried out in a couple of hours, while substantial damage might require a few days.
